Shims (Part No.: 3115029702 3EA) – Precision Alignment Components for Hydraulic Rock Drills

Hydraulic rock drills are critical to mining, quarrying, and construction, where tight tolerances drive efficiency and equipment lifespan. Shims (Part No.: 3115029702 3EA) are essential spacing and alignment parts for these tools, and moreover, we engineer them to strict OEM specs for a seamless fit that eliminates misalignment, reduces wear, and sustains peak performance in harsh, high-vibration environments.

Core Functions

1. Micron-Level Spacing

These shims deliver precise gap control between drill pistons, valves, and gears, and therefore, they prevent metal-to-metal friction, seal leaks, and hydraulic system breakdowns even under heavy loads.

2. Vibration Dampening

Hydraulic rock drills generate intense shock during operation, and as a result, these shims act as a buffer to absorb vibration, reducing stress on internal systems and extending the service life of adjacent components like drill rods.

Durable Construction

1. Wear-Resistant Alloy Steel

We use premium alloy steel for these shims, and unlike low-carbon alternatives, this material resists warping and abrasion, retaining its shape despite exposure to rock dust and impact.

2. Corrosion-Resistant Heat Treatment

Every shim undergoes targeted heat treatment; additionally, this process boosts surface hardness and forms a protective oxide layer, shielding against rust and hydraulic fluid corrosion for long-lasting use.
